Newman and Jones 100 Best Horror Novels

Tags: 
  1. Christopher Marlowe - The Tragical History of Doctor Faustus
  2. William Shakespeare - The Tragedy of Macbeth
  3. John Webster - The White Devil
  4. William Godwin - Things As They Are; or: The Adventures of Caleb Williams
  5. Matthew Gregory Lewis - The Monk: A Romance
  6. E.T.A. Hoffmann - The Best Tales of Hoffmann
  7. Jane Austen - Northanger Abbey
  8. Mary Shelley - Frankenstein
  9. Charles Maturin - Melmoth the Wanderer
  10. James Hogg - The Private Memoirs and Confessions of a Justified Sinner
  11. Edgar Allen Poe - Tales of Mystery and Imagination
  12. Nathaniel Hawthorne - Twice-Told Tales
  13. Jeremias Gotthelf - The Black Spider
  14. Eugène Sue - The Wandering Jew
  15. Herman Melville - The Confidence Man: His Masquerade
  16. J. Sheridan Le Fanu - Uncle Silas: A Tale of Bertram-Haugh
  17. Robert Louis Stevenson - The Strange Case of Dr. Jekyll and Mr. Hyde
  18. H. Rider Haggard - She
  19. Robert W. Chambers - The King in Yellow
  20. H.G. Wells - The Island of Dr. Moreau
  21. Bram Stoker - Dracula
  22. Henry James The Turn of the Screw
  23. Joseph Conrad - Heart of Darkness
  24. Bram Stoker - The Jewel of Seven Stars
  25. M.R. James - Ghost Stories of an Antiquary
  26. Arthur Machen - The House of Souls
  27. Algernon Blackwood - John Silence, Physician Extraordinary
  28. G.K. Chesterton - The Man Who Was Thursday
  29. William Hope Hodgson - The House On the Borderland
  30. Ambrose Bierce - The Collected Works of Ambrose Bierce
  31. Oliver Onions - Widdershins
  32. E.F. Benson - The Horror Horn: The Best Horror Stories of E.F. Benson
  33. David Lindsay - A Voyage To Arcturus
  34. Franz Kafka - The Trial
  35. James Branch Cabell - Something About Eve
  36. E.H. Visiak - Medusa
  37. Guy -The Werewolf of Paris
  38. Marjorie Bowen - The Last Bouquet: Some Twilight Tales
  39. Alexander Laing - The Cadaver of Gideaon Wyck
  40. Sir Hugh Walpole (ed) - A Second Century of Creepy Stories
  41. C.S. Lewis - The Dark Tower and The Day After Judgment
  42. Dalton Trumbo - Johnny Got His Gun
  43. H.P Lovecraft - The Outsider and Others
  44. Clark Ashton Smith - Out of Space and Time
  45. Fritz Leiber - Conjure Wife
  46. Cornell Woolrich - Night Has a Thousand Eyes
  47. H.P. Lovecraft and August Derleth - The Lurker at the Threshold
  48. Paul Bailey - Deliver Me From Eva
  49. Boris Karloff (ed) - And the Darkness Falls
  50. August Derleth (ed) - The Sleeping and the Dead
  51. Walter Van Tilburg Clark - Track of the Cat
  52. Sarban - The Sound of His Horn
  53. William Golding - Lord of the Flies
  54. Richard Matherson - I Am Legend
  55. Ray Bradbury - The October Country
  56. Joseph Payne Brennan - Nine Horrors and a Dream
  57. Robert Bloch - Psycho
  58. Nigel Kneale - Quatermass and the Pit
  59. H.P. Lovecraft - Cry Horror!
  60. Shirley Jackson - The Haunting of Hill House
  61. Philip K. Dick - The Three Stigmata of Palmer Eldritch
  62. Jerzy kosinski - The Painted Bird
  63. J.G. Ballard - The Crystal World
  64. Robert Aikman - Sub Rosa
  65. Kingsley Amis - The Green Man
  66. Anthony Boucher - The Compleat Werewolf, and Other Stories of Fantasy and Science Fiction
  67. John Gardner - Grendel
  68. William Peter Blatty - The Exorcist
  69. John Brunner - The Sheep Look Up
  70. Manly Wade Wellman - Worse Things Waiting
  71. Robert Marasco - Burnt Offerings
  72. Stephen King - Salems's Lot
  73. Harlan Ellison - Deathbird Stories
  74. Hugh B. Cave - Murgunstrumm and Others
  75. Bernard Taylor - Sweetheart, Sweetheart
  76. John Farris - All Heads Turn When the Hunt Goes By
  77. Stephen King - The Shining
  78. William Hjortsberg - Falling Angel
  79. Whitely Streiber - The Wolfen
  80. David Morrell - The Totem
  81. Peter Straub - Ghost Story
  82. Jonathan Carroll - The Land of Laughs
  83. Richard Laymon - The Cellar
  84. Thomas Harris - Red Dragon
  85. F. Paul Wilson - The Keep
  86. Deniis Etchison - The Dark Country
  87. Karl Edward Wagner - In a Lonely Place
  88. Tim Powers - The Anubis Gates
  89. Robert Irwin - The Arabian Nightmare
  90. Iain Banks - The Wasp Factory
  91. T.E.D. Klein - The Ceremonies
  92. Robert Holdstock - Mythago Wood
  93. Michael Bishop - Who Made Stevie Crye?
  94. Dan Simmons - The Song of Kali
  95. Clive Barker - The Damnation Game
  96. Peter Ackroyd - Hawksmoor
  97. Lisa Tuttle - A Nest of Nightmares
  98. Charles L. Grant - The Pet
  99. Robert McCammon - Swan Song
  100. Ramsey Campbell - Dark Feasts
